Attendees: senior management and finance leadership of Torvane Industries. The committee reviewed gross margins across the Pellin and Arcova product lines. Pellin margins declined 1.8 points, attributed to freight costs on the Marrow Lake route; Arcova held steady at 41%. Finance was asked to model a supplier consolidation scenario by month-end, and procurement will report on alternative sourcing at the next session. Minutes approved by the chair. The confidential note appended below is restricted to meeting attendees.

management briefing: Project Ulavan slips by two quarters because of the staffing delay.

We rotated the signing credentials used when Torvane calls the upstream Pellwick Rates API, after the old pair passed its 90-day window. At the same time we enabled a circuit breaker: after five consecutive 5xx responses, Torvane pauses Pellwick calls for two minutes and serves cached rates, logging a clear breaker-open event so support can confirm it quickly. Tickets about stale rates during the pause are expected behavior. For verification of signed payloads, use the current key shown below.

deploy key for yajeg-hahog: bky3_BZq

## Service Accounts: Localization Pipeline

Quick heads-up for reviewers: the date-format localization jobs in Calenda run under a dedicated service account, not a developer identity. The account pulls locale bundles from the internal Formatry service nightly and rewrites date patterns per region — so if you see odd commits touching format templates, that's the bot, not a human. When reviewing changes to the pipeline config, verify calls authenticate with the service key below.

service key, kaduf-bawig: kto15_Ze79S0dligTw0yO